1

How to improve the efficiency of roof repair Moreno Valley through smart planning

News Discuss 
A Full Overview to Roof Solutions: Necessary Installment Strategies, Repair Work Solutions, and Ongoing Upkeep An extensive understanding of roof services is essential for house owners. It encompasses various aspects, from choosing proper materials to applying efficient setup strategies. Repair services also play a key function in keeping a roofing's https://cristianprrom.onesmablog.com/the-leading-commercial-roofing-riverside-systems-for-long-lasting-protection-79176433

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story